Usman replaces Laleye as Army spokesman JANUARY 22, 2015 BY FIDELIS SORIWEI, ABUJA 76 Comments The authorities of the Nigerian Army have appointed a new Spokesman for the service in person of Col. SK Usman. Investigations revealed that SK Usman is expected to take over from the current Director, Army Public Relations, Brig. Gen. Olajide Laleye, who is on transfer to the 4th Brigade of the Nigeria Army, Benin, as the Commander. Until his appointment, Col. Usman was the Spokesman of the 7th Division of the Nigerian Army, Maiduguri. It was gathered that Usman was redeployed to take over the Directorate of the Army Public Relations because of his effectiveness as the Spokesman of the sensitive 7th Division which is entrusted with the responsibility of coordinating the campaign against insurgency in the North-East. Before his deployment to the 7th division in 2014, Usman also served as the Chief of Staff in the Office of the Director, Army Public Relations. It was stated that Usman would take over as Acting Spokesperson because the office of the Director, Army Public Relations is usually for officers of the rank of Brig. General. Usman’s posting to the Directorate of Army Public Relations was as a result of a recent deployment of senior officers of the Nigerian Army approved by the Chief of Army Staff, Lt. Gen Kenneth Minimah. The Army Spokesman, Laleye, had said, in a telephone interview with our correspondent, on the issue on Wednesday that “the Army would make a formal reaction on redeployments within the service later.” Other recent postings by the Army include Maj. Gen. E. Adeosun, who takes over from Maj. Gen. Ibrahim as General Officer Commanding the 7th Infantry Division, Maiduguri. Adeosun was the Commander, 14th Brigade of the Army, Ohaffia, Abia State. It was learnt that Ibrahim who had been coordinating the recent campaigns against the insurgency was moved to the Army Headquarters, Abuja “to occupy a very high position.” It was further learnt that the GOC in charge of the 2nd Division, Ibadan, Maj. Gen. Abejirin, had retired from the service ‘after years of meritorious service.’ Abejirin is to be replaced by Maj. Gen. I.M. Muazu as GOC. Laleye had said on Monday that, “the Nigerian Army has carried out postings as a result of promotions and retirements. Postings are done periodically in the Army as a result of promotions and retirements.”
